This is the friendly front door. The chain still decides payment acceptance, admission, retention behavior, proofs, repair, provider settlement, and public evidence labels.
The browser sends the file to public intake.
Infra records size and SHA-256 in the manifest.
Fee math prices bytes and class into BIGHT.
The gateway spends quoted BIGHT on the product service rail.
The receipt records the proof handle, class, payment, hash, and admission trail.
Later proof lanes can challenge retention and retrieval.
